what I watched of the MP footage from SideStrafe shows some pretty good gameplay, but if you get killed it's a long hike back to the front.

do the spawn points advance as you capture more territory?

That depends on the gamemode. The first (foggy) map was very small and you couldn't spawn at captured points (at least I couldn't ... or couldn't figure out how to do it^^), yet I am not sure how this is handled on bigger maps with the same gametype (C&H gamemode).
For the second map (CH gamemode) I am not 100% sure, but I think you can somehow use the ambulance trucks you can see in the video as mobile spawn points, but I haven't yet figured out how to do it.

And in Blitzkrieg (which is based on A&S) you can spawn at any captured point.

Btw: the first map was not Blitzkrieg as Sidestrafe said, it was C&H as you can see at the end of the round.
